Regina Weather in March

Regina in March sees very low daytime temperatures of 2°C (36°F) and nighttime lows of -9°C (16°F). Low snow/rainfall is typical, with around 25 mm (1 in) for the month.

Rainfall in Regina in March

Past climate data indicates that roughly 7 days will see snow/rain, totalling around 25 mm (1 in) for the month. Rain is scarce this month and when it does fall, it tends to be light. Unlikely to disrupt plans significantly.

Temperature in Regina in March

In March, Regina gets very low temperatures, with highs of 2°C (36°F). Nights cool to around -9°C (16°F). Staying warm is the main priority this month, especially during mornings and evenings. Nights are well below freezing at -9°C (16°F). An extra blanket is a good idea if you feel the cold, especially in older or less well-heated accommodation. Prepare for low temperatures this month by wearing plenty of layers. It's essential to stay warm in such cold conditions.

Sunshine in Regina in March

The month experiences a moderate amount of sunlight, with 158 hours of sunshine. This provides a nice balance between sunshine and clouds.
